Surge Fall to Hooks

May 27, 2022 - Texas League (TL)
Wichita Wind Surge News Release


Corpus Christi, Texas- The Wind Surge fell short to the Corpus Christi Hooks 9-5 on Thursday night as eleven hits and nine runs fueled the Hooks comeback to victory.

Wichita struck first as Chris Williams hit a three-run homer in the top of the first inning to give the Surge an early 3-0 lead. Williams finished the night one for four with three RBIs.

Matt Wallner hit a two-run homer in the top of the third inning to extend the Surge lead to 5-2. Wallner finished the night going one for three with two RBIs and a walk.

Corpus Christi scored two runs in the first inning and three runs in the third inning that tied the ball game 5-5. Shay Whitcomb hit a two-run homer in the seventh inning to give the Hooks a 7-5 lead. Corpus Christi scored two more insurance runs that would go on to secure the 9-5 win.

The Surge offense was limited to four hits in the second consecutive game.

Notes: Ben Gross was placed on 7-day injured list... Austin Martin recorded his 19th stolen base on the season... The Surge lost their first Thursday game of the season (5-1)... Chris Williams extended his hit streak to ten games...Matt Wallner hit his ninth home run of the season and now leads the Surge in homers...
